Banks Earns National Recognition...Again

December 7, 2009 - Junior midfielder J.C. Banks (Milwaukee, Wis.) has been named to the second team of the year at Goal.com; a nationally known soccer website and magazine. Along with Banks, 32 other players throughout the country have received first, second and third team honors.

Banks led the Phoenix men's soccer team in goals (13), assists (10), points (36) and shots (73) in Green Bay's impressive 14-3-3 season. He also led the Horizon League in shots, shots per game (3.65), points, points per game (1.80), goals, goals per game (0.65) and assists before claiming the program's first ever Horizon League Player of the Year award.

In November, Banks was also named to the TopDrawerSoccer's Men's College Team of the Season. Banks was selected to the national second team along with ten other players throughout the country.

For the first time in program history, the Green Bay men's soccer team won the Horizon League Championship in which Banks was named to the all-tournament team. Green Bay capped off their 2009 season with the team's first trip to the NCA A tournament in 26 years.
